Baden-Baden is a charming resort town in southwest Germany, known for its thermal springs, elegant gardens, and historical landmarks. Here is an example of a 2-day tourist guide in this beautiful place.
Day 1
Morning:
- Caracalla Thermal Baths: Start your morning with a memorable visit to the Caracalla Baths. Enjoy the thermal pools, saunas, and spa treatments.
Lunch:
- Café Lunch: Find a cozy café in the city center and try traditional German dishes like Swabian spaetzle or beef stroganoff.
Afternoon:
- Lichtentaler Allee: Stroll along this historic alley lined with luxurious parks and gardens. It is especially beautiful in the fall when the trees change colors.
- Museum Frieder Burda: Join a tour of this modern art museum, which houses outstanding works of contemporary and classical art.
Evening:
- Kurhaus & Casino Baden-Baden: End the day with a visit to the elegant Kurhaus, where you can enjoy dinner at the restaurant and try your luck at the famous casino.
Day 2
Morning:
- Hohenbaden Castle: Climb to the ruins of Hohenbaden Castle in the morning. This spot offers breathtaking views of the city and its surroundings.
